Bank owned REO (Real Estate Owned) properties is where the market is right now, Every Buyer we have spoken to is buying or looking for a bank owned foreclosed property. If you are not working with a Bank, I suggest you make some calls and get a hold of their REO list of homes available. If you don't know who to call a great way will be to look at the settlement sheet (HUD1) of some of your past closings and call the Lender on the sheet, ask for their REO Dept., a great way to build a relationship with the Lender.

 Its a very unique market right now, Buyers are out there looking for the right deal, take advantage of it make the call !
